The error message "variable might be used before it is defined" typically occurs when you're trying to use a variable before it has been assigned a value or initialized. This error can often be resolved by ensuring that you define or initialize your variables properly before using them in your MATLAB code. In this code, 'yy3' has been used to initialise 'yy2' before being initialised itself. You want to have an initial value for 'yy3' before using it to resolve this error.
